John will work tirelessly to strengthen the Affordable Care Act by creating a “public option” for health care insurance nationally. He joins Colorado leaders like Senator Michael Bennet in supporting an expansive national public insurance option, which would introduce competition into the healthcare market, provide an affordable and high-quality option for every uninsured American, and drive down costs for everyone.

He will also work to rebuild the Affordable Care Act after years of Republican efforts to undermine the law. Cory Gardner and his allies have turned Obamacare into a shell of itself, repealing key provisions of the law like reinsurance subsidies and gutting the individual mandate. These measures were designed to keep costs down for all. If they get their way, protections for pre-existing conditions could soon disappear.

John will also focus on lowering the cost of prescription drugs. As Colorado’s U.S. Attorney, he secured some of the largest penalties against multinational drug companies in history, because those drug companies -- companies like GlaxoSmithKline -- were defrauding Colorado patients.
